Professional Information

Amy Gonzales loves sharing her passion for music with her students.  She is currently teaching K-5 general music and has been at the same school for the past 24 years.  Amy also appreciates technology in education and continues to search for new ways to incorporate technology into her classroom as well as share that knowledge with other educators.  In her spare time, Amy volunteers at Dakota Ridge Church as a musician, singer, and children's seasonal musical director. She resides in Littleton, CO with her amazing family.
